We report the electrical properties of inverted P3HT:PC71BM bulk hetero-junction (IBHJ) with Cs2CO3 and MoO3 interlayers. The current density (J)-voltage (V) characteristics of the inverted P3HT:PC71BM bulk hetero-junction solar cells are studied, where MoO3 thickness is varied from 0.5 to 2 nm. The temperature independent, symmetric J-V characteristics in dark were found in the low bias voltage region between -0.35 and 0.35 V, and they exhibited the power law relationship J-V-1,V-2 when the MoO3 thickness is between 1 and 2 nm. Open-circuit voltages at various light intensities of the IBIAJ cell plotted as a function of absolute temperature converge to similar to 0.965 Vat zero temperature, which is very close to the energy difference between LUMO of PC71BM and HOMO of P3HT.
